Understanding the Contrasts: Frontend vs. Backend Development

25 Sep 2025

Understanding the Contrasts: Frontend vs. Backend Development

In the realm of Scarborough web design, two key players shape the digital landscape: frontend and backend development. While both are essential building blocks, they serve distinct purposes, requiring unique skill sets and approaches. Let's delve into the differences between frontend and backend development to gain a comprehensive understanding of their roles and significance.

Frontend Development: Bringing Designs to Life

Frontend development focuses on the visible aspects of a website or application that users interact with. It involves utilizing JavaScript to create an engaging and responsive interface. Frontend developers prioritize UI/UX design, ensuring seamless navigation and visually appealing layouts.

Client-side development is like crafting the facade of a house; it's what users see and interact with directly.

Key Aspects of Frontend Development

  • Responsive design for various devices
  • Cross-browser compatibility
  • Image and code compression for faster loading times
  • Integration of APIs

Backend Development: Powering the Core Functionality

Server-side development focuses on the behind-the-scenes functionality of a website or application. It involves working with databases, servers, and applications to ensure smooth operations. Backend developers are responsible for data management, security measures, and system performance.

Backend development is like the foundation of a house; it supports everything above ground, ensuring stability and reliability.

Key Aspects of Backend Development

  • Data storage and retrieval
  • Optimizing server performance
  • Implementing encryption and secure connections
  • Connecting with external services for data exchange

Choosing the Right Path: Frontend vs. Backend

When embarking on a career in web development, aspiring developers often ponder whether to specialize in frontend or backend technologies. While both paths offer rewarding opportunities, it ultimately boils down to personal preferences and strengths. Some thrive on the design intricacies of frontend development, while others excel in the system optimizations of backend development.

Deciding on between frontend and backend development is akin to picking between painting a masterpiece.

Factors to Consider

  • Interest and Aptitude: Assess your creativity and see which aspect resonates more.
  • Job Market Demand: Research the job opportunities for frontend and backend developers.
  • Career Growth: Explore the professional growth in each specialization.

In Conclusion: Navigating the Development Landscape

As we wrap up our exploration of frontend and backend development, it's clear that both realms offer unique challenges and rewards. Whether you choose to embark on the technical voyage of frontend development or delve into the structural integrity of backend development, remember that versatility and continuous learning are key to thriving in the dynamic field of web development.

Embrace the challenges that frontend and backend development present, and build a successful career fueled by your passion for creating innovative digital experiences.

Chelsea Hamilton
Chelsea Hamilton

A passionate writer and Dutch culture enthusiast, sharing her love for all things Holland through engaging content.